About This Skill
What it does
This skill, Solid Drawing Mastery, teaches techniques for creating realistic three-dimensional forms and ensuring consistent proportions in your drawings and animations. It focuses on understanding volume, perspective, and weight to avoid common pitfalls like objects growing or shrinking during motion or warping into incorrect shapes. The core principle is shifting from drawing symbols to drawing volumes that exist within a 3D space.
When to use it
- When creating character animation where consistent proportions and realistic movement are crucial.
- For UI/Motion Design projects requiring accurate perspective in rotations, scaling animations, or card flips.
- In Motion Graphics to create pseudo-3D effects like parallax and depth that feel spatially correct.
- To improve the realism of sprite animation in game design by implying 3D form in a 2D representation.
Key capabilities
- Form over Symbol: Understanding and drawing volumes instead of simplified shapes.
- Construction Consistency: Maintaining consistent proportions throughout motion.
- Volume Consistency: Preventing objects from accidentally growing or shrinking.
- Perspective Accuracy: Ensuring rotations adhere to dimensional rules.
- Weight Presence: Creating forms that feel like they have mass and occupy space.

Tips & gotchas
- This skill focuses on principles applicable to both traditional and digital art. It's not a shortcut to artistic talent, but rather a framework for understanding how to create believable forms.
- Pay close attention to the concept of "construction" - understanding the underlying structure (like a skeleton) that supports your visible shapes.
